Here we go! Steve Harvey is doing exactly what his ex-wife Mary Harvey said he would. BlackVoices.com has claimed to report ‘a judge in District Court in Collin County, Texas has approved the release of legal documents that prove allegations from Harvey’s ex-wife, Mary Shackelford, were indeed false.’

BV also claims this: “Contrary to Shackleford’s malicious accusations, the new document states that she was not left homeless by Harvey following their divorce, but was awarded three homes as a result of their property settlement. Adding to that, she was also paid $40,000 a month until March 2009 and then paid a lump sum of $1.5 million.”

It was also stated that Mary Harvey allegedly sent their son Wynton to Steve’s home by airplane unknowingly to him. So he states that she just put her son on a plane and to never see her again which she stated it was just for a visit that was agreed to.

Pretty much everything that Mary Harvey claimed in her videos and on interviews, Steve Harvey has apparently used is stature, clout and influence to try and prove Mary wrong. We guess we will believe it when we see it.
